Our story

Built by buyers, for buyers

NEXPLAYA began in 2018 when a group of camp directors and retail buyers grew tired of chasing down mismatched seasonal orders. We wanted one place where every surface — sand, hardwood, turf, training floor — had a ready-to-ship bundle. So we built it.

Today we curate gear by play zone and season, ship from three regional distribution hubs, and serve buyers across North America who need colorful, reliable sports kits without the procurement headache.

Operations snapshot

How we keep orders moving

Dedicated account managers

Orders over ₹2,00,000 are paired with a wholesale rep who knows your season, your quantities and your delivery windows.

Pre-ship quality control

We inspect at the carton level, verify counts, and flag issues before your shipment leaves the warehouse.

Three regional hubs

Our distribution network covers East, Central and West zones so most in-stock orders ship within two business days.

Seasonal reorder tools

Save kit lists, duplicate past orders and lock in seasonal pricing for your next opening or restock.

Branding & customization

Logo-ready apparel and branded resort kits are available with minimum order quantities and art guidelines.

Sustainable packaging

Recyclable cartons, bulk inner packs and a seasonal reuse program help cut down on single-use waste.
